首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

访问Camel EIP bean内的消息体元素

Camel EIP(Enterprise Integration Patterns)是一个开源的集成框架,用于在企业应用中实现各种集成模式。它提供了一种灵活且可扩展的方式来连接不同的应用程序、服务和系统。

在Camel EIP中,bean是一种组件,用于处理消息的转换和处理。它可以是一个简单的Java类,也可以是一个Spring bean。访问Camel EIP bean内的消息体元素可以通过以下步骤实现:

  1. 配置Camel路由:在Camel路由配置文件中,使用from指令指定消息来源,使用to指令指定消息的目的地。可以使用各种协议和传输方式来定义消息来源和目的地。
  2. 定义Bean:在Camel路由配置文件中,使用bean指令定义一个Bean组件。可以指定Bean的类名、方法名和参数。
  3. 访问消息体元素:在Bean的方法中,可以通过参数来访问消息体元素。Camel会自动将消息体转换为方法参数,并将处理结果作为消息的响应。

Camel EIP的优势在于它提供了丰富的集成模式和组件,可以轻松地实现各种复杂的集成场景。它还具有高度可扩展性和灵活性,可以与其他框架和技术无缝集成。

在腾讯云的产品中,推荐使用腾讯云的Serverless Framework(https://cloud.tencent.com/product/sls)来部署和管理Camel EIP应用。Serverless Framework提供了一种无服务器的方式来构建和部署应用程序,可以大大简化应用程序的开发和运维工作。

希望以上回答能够满足您的需求,如果还有其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券